The Blockchain Regulatory Certainty Act (BRCA) is making waves in the Senate, promising to reshape the regulatory environment for blockchain developers. But as lawmakers debate its merits, the act appears to be a double-edged sword for those it seeks to guide.
Opinion: While the BRCA aims to provide clarity, its implications could either empower or encumber developers, depending on how it's wielded.
What we know
- The BRCA is part of a broader legislative effort to bring clarity to crypto market structures, as reported by Bitcoin Magazine.
- The bill seeks to define and regulate the roles of blockchain developers and service providers more clearly.
- According to Cointelegraph, the Senate Banking Committee is actively involved in drafting and discussing the bill's provisions.
- The act is seen as a companion to the CLARITY Act, which also targets regulatory transparency in the blockchain sector.
- There's a focus on distinguishing between different types of blockchain activities and their regulatory requirements.
The take
The BRCA's intentions are noble—offering developers a clearer regulatory roadmap. However, the devil is in the details. By defining specific roles and responsibilities, the act could unintentionally stifle innovation if the regulations become too prescriptive. Developers might find themselves navigating a labyrinth of compliance rather than focusing on innovation.
Moreover, the BRCA's success hinges on its implementation. If executed with flexibility and foresight, it could indeed provide the clarity developers crave. However, a rigid approach could lead to an environment where only the most resource-rich entities can thrive.
Counterpoints
- Some argue that any regulation is better than the current uncertainty, which leaves developers in a legal gray area.
- Others believe that the act could spur investment by providing a more predictable environment for blockchain projects.
- There is also a view that the act could protect consumers by ensuring that developers adhere to certain standards.
- Critics suggest that the act's impact will vary greatly depending on the final wording and enforcement mechanisms.
